Output efc30f957f667791b8b84d006f95720fb7f45e69140280ad3c02a8153a91ca46:0

value
15000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3d758ffc545fea62b8258855b4e5024590cd76b OP_EQUALVERIFY OP_CHECKSIG
address
1MmiNASRhCiWYjATetRFS3ztUVMZ3QdvF5
transaction
efc30f957f667791b8b84d006f95720fb7f45e69140280ad3c02a8153a91ca46
spent
true